| Biography: |
Pro Highlights:
Currently second on the all-time sack list to Reggie White (198) with 186. Smith is the All-time NFL playoff sack leader with 14.5.
He has sacked 69 different quarterbacks in his career; adding Seahawks quarterbacks Matt Hasselback and Trent Dilfer, New Orleans QB Aaron Brooks and Dallas quarterback Quincy Carter to the list in 2001.
Smith is a perennial All-Pro with trips to the Pro Bowl 11 of his 17 seasons and each year from 1992-98. And after posteing 10 sacks in 2000, he set the NFL record for most double-digit sack seasons (13).
Holds a second-place tie with Lawrence Taylor for most consecutive seasons with double-digit sacks (seven).
Durable, he has started 243 of a possible 247 games overall during his career.
Sacked Carolina QB Steve Beuerlein for a 21-yard loss (9/3/00), a career-long for Smith.
Won ninth Player of the Week Award, the most among active players, after 3.0-sack, one safety, five-tackle performance at St. Louis (11/20/00).
Named NFL Defensive Player of the Year in 1990 and 1996.
Collected career-highs of 120 tackles (1996), 54 QB pressures (1996), 19.0 sacks (1990) and four fumble recoveries (1985).
